Globowl Cafe Food Trailer in Lexington is a hole in the wall that feels like a gem. The place is modern, elegant yet not boring, and has an open kitchen and extended wine selection. The staff is top‑notch, knowledgeable and patient. Clean‑eating vegan options are plentiful, and vegetarian and a few omnivorous dishes are also available. The Buddha bowl is amazing with rice, sweet potatoes and alternative protein. The empanadas are flavorful and the shawarma wrap with tzatziki sauce is also amazing. The lavender/ blueberry cheesecake is rich and bright. The matcha coconut milk latte is pretty but not for everyone. Vegan desserts are offered. The restaurant is small but can seat up to eight inside and has sidewalk tables outside. Wheelchair access is easy because the door has no step. Portions are generous and the food is fresh‑cooked. Many diners recommend the Buddha bowl with tofu and the Bombay Bowl. The vibe is funky, and the ambiance is warm. It is a good stop for road trips between DC and North Carolina, and a 10‑min drive off the interstate into Lexington is worth it.
